Output ec2488c60612033e0579958b43c01ca22252c33f0033608ce8f79957f323713b:12

value
16963
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f369e2288b95e7ef2c2e5784ee145ad84626faf036d24f3173878d52df9fa902
address
ltc1p7d57y2ytjhn77tpw27zwu9z6mprzd7hsxmfy7vtns7x49hul4ypqprscsn
transaction
ec2488c60612033e0579958b43c01ca22252c33f0033608ce8f79957f323713b
spent
true